Autumn Park Apartments presents itself as a place with a strong sense of security and a few paradoxes. On one hand, the building isn't shy about its protective measures: cameras on every level create a feeling of being watched over, which the writer acknowledges with a mix of reassurance and a touch of paranoia. The presence of cameras is framed as a security feature that leans into the resident's comfort level, even if it also feeds a bit of nervousness about safety in the building.
Temperature and common spaces are also a notable part of the experience. The higher-level apartments "stay fairly warm in the winter," a detail that suggests good insulation or heating performance in the upper floors. In addition to living quarters, there are practical conveniences and social spaces downstairs: vending machines, a pool table, and a dart board provide accessible recreation and practical needs without leaving the building. These amenities paint a picture of a property that values a community feel and easy lifestyle, even if some areas aren't always available for use.
However, there are several drawbacks that keep the place from feeling flawless. A recurring complaint centers on noise and smell: there are gaps at the bottom of the doors that let in odors from neighbors' cooking and smoking, so "the smells often fill the halls." This kind of design flaw can significantly affect day-to-day comfort and sleep, especially in a place that already has other quirks. Speaking of sleep, the writer notes a rather unusual adjustment: to avoid being startled by a newly installed fire alarm speaker in the bedroom, they have chosen to sleep in the living room. The bedroom itself also lacks a light, meaning residents must bring their own lighting, which is an inconvenience that can complicate long-term comfort.
Pest history adds another layer to the building's story. The reviews mention bedbugs and roaches as problems in the past, though the writer emphasizes they haven't seen them in a good five years. That gap provides a sense of relief, yet the two-word reminder - "bed bugs" - acts as a blunt marker of past trouble and the lingering vigilance some tenants feel when considering a move into a residence with a history of pests.

Autumn Park Apartments in Hastings, NE is an assisted living community offering a range of amenities and care services to meet the needs of its residents. The community provides devotional services off-site and indoor common areas where residents can socialize and engage in activities.
For those with specific care needs, Autumn Park Apartments offers diabetic care to ensure that residents with diabetes receive the necessary support and assistance to manage their condition effectively.
Residents at Autumn Park Apartments have access to various activities, including devotional activities offsite. This provides them with opportunities to engage in spiritual practices and maintain their faith.
Located in Hastings, NE, this community benefits from its convenient location near several amenities. There are c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, transportation options, places of worship, theaters, and hospitals nearby. This proximity allows residents to easily access these establishments for their daily requirements or recreational purposes.
